MALAYSIA is considering a mediation role in the border dispute between Thailand and Cambodia over land surrounding the Preah Vihear temple.
An aide to foreign minister Rais Yatim, who declined to be named, says he will try to get Cabinet approval today to visit Cambodia and Thailand.
